构建高效安全的VPN加速软件,从技术原理到实践部署指南

dfbn6 2026-04-23 vpn 1 0

在当今数字化时代,远程办公、跨国协作和隐私保护需求日益增长,虚拟私人网络(VPN)已成为企业和个人用户保障网络安全与提升访问效率的核心工具,传统VPN在面对高延迟、带宽瓶颈或地理位置限制时往往表现不佳,开发一套具备“加速”能力的定制化VPN软件,不仅是技术趋势,更是提升用户体验的关键一步,本文将深入探讨如何从底层架构设计、协议优化到实际部署,构建一个兼具安全性与高性能的VPN加速解决方案。

明确“加速”的定义至关重要,它不仅指数据传输速度的提升,更包括连接建立时间缩短、延迟降低、丢包率减少以及智能路由选择等综合性能优化,为此,我们需要从三个关键技术维度入手:协议层优化、网络拓扑设计和边缘计算集成。

在协议层面,传统OpenVPN基于TCP协议虽稳定但存在拥塞控制慢、握手延迟高的问题,建议采用WireGuard协议作为基础,其使用UDP传输、轻量级加密算法(如ChaCha20-Poly1305)和极简代码结构,显著提升了吞吐量和连接速度,可引入QUIC(快速UDP互联网连接)协议实现多路复用和前向纠错功能,进一步减少重传和排队延迟。

网络拓扑方面,应采用“全球节点+智能路由”策略,通过在全球多个区域部署高速服务器节点(如北美、欧洲、亚太),并结合BGP(边界网关协议)动态路由算法,让客户端自动选择最优路径,当用户在中国访问美国资源时,系统可根据实时链路质量(如RTT、抖动、可用带宽)推荐最近且负载最低的节点,避免绕行拥堵链路。

第三,边缘计算是实现“加速”的关键创新点,将部分数据处理任务下沉至靠近用户的边缘服务器(如CDN节点),可大幅减少端到端延迟,在视频会议类应用中,边缘节点可预先缓存常用内容、进行流量整形,并利用本地DNS解析加快域名解析速度,结合AI预测模型对用户行为进行分析(如常访问网站、时间段规律),提前预加载资源,实现“感知式加速”。

部署阶段需兼顾易用性与安全性,提供图形化客户端界面,支持一键连接、自动故障切换和状态监控;后端则需实施严格的身份认证(如双因素认证)、日志审计和DDoS防护机制,遵循GDPR等国际隐私法规,确保用户数据不被滥用。

构建一个真正意义上的“VPN加速软件”,不是简单叠加硬件或更换协议,而是融合网络工程、云计算和人工智能的系统性工程,对于网络工程师而言,这既是挑战也是机遇——掌握核心技术,才能在复杂多变的数字环境中,为用户提供既快又稳的连接体验。

构建高效安全的VPN加速软件,从技术原理到实践部署指南

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N